This is my fathers favorite place to go when we are up north. The ice cream is defiantly creamier than at other ice cream shops. He talks about the Michigan Black Cherry Ice cream all year and always asks when they will be open, as it is seasonal. All and all it is a must stop if you find yourself near Rogers City. The owner and staff are very personable and will take the time to chat if they are not overly busy. The view of the lake and the park are incredible. Feels like you are in a 1950s movie.

We got lunch there as we were riding our bikes. I had the chili cheese hot dog, and my wife had a regular hot dog. We didn't realize they came with potato chips, so as a side, we ordered chips and nacho cheese. They had a wider variety than I would have expected for this type of establishment. The crew was very friendly, and the service was prompt. It was in the park over looking Lake Huron, so a great view. To top it off, we had a sunny day.
It's a little pricey for the relatively small portions you get. $7.99 for 5 cream cheese Jalapeno Poppers. I believe also was $7.99 for one Chili dog with cheese, and that only includes chips, no fries or drink. I like supporting local but you aren't getting much bang for your buck here.
We discovered The Pavilion Grill on our bike ride from Hoeft State Park into Rogers City. We were looking for a light lunch before our ride back and they were perfect. The hot dogs are made locally and were yummy. We also enjoyed a pina colada slushee. The only thing that would have made it better was a shot of rum!????. Above all, you can't beat their location. As we have now purchased property in the area, we are looking forward to many more lunches there in the future.
